K20 Engines Unique Structure
While many engines boast outstanding specs, it is the distinct structure of the K20 engine that establishes it apart. Honda, the manufacturer, designed this engine as part of the K-series, which are four-cylinder, four-stroke engines. The K20, specifically, features a light weight aluminum cyndrical tube block with an actors iron cyndrical tube lining. Its small structure is amazing for its high-revving nature, which is supported by a double overhead camshaft (DOHC) design. This DOHC layout, incorporated with the VTEC system (Variable Shutoff Timing and Raise Electronic Control), guarantees efficient fuel combustion and a wide powerband. Such a taken into consideration framework is among the reasons the K20 engine has actually acquired an online reputation for its high efficiency and dependability.
Efficiency Characteristics and Specifications
In order to truly recognize the K20 engine's excellent efficiency, one should explore its intricate layout and technological specifications. This resourceful engine, a product of Honda's engineering expertise, boasts a 2.0 L variation, and a four-cylinder, DOHC i-VTEC setup. Its layout enables a peak power outcome of approximately 200 horsepower, running effectively at 7,800 RPM. The K20 engine also includes a high compression ratio of 11:1, boosting fuel effectiveness and power generation. Moreover, its light-weight building, attained through the usage of an aluminium block and head, improves the power-to-weight proportion, offering a side in regards to acceleration and handling. Keep in mind that the K20's performance is likewise considerably affected by its specific transmission pairing and adjusting.

Style Includes Enhancing Performance
Despite its portable dimension, the K20 engine boasts a number of style features that considerably enhance its performance. Recognized for its high-revving nature, it uses a dual expenses camshaft (DOHC) design, which enables far better shutoff control and higher performance at faster rates. The application of Honda's i-VTEC system more optimizes shutoff timing, adding to the K20's remarkable power result. A considerably square birthed and stroke proportion aids in accomplishing an equilibrium in between torque and horse power. This engine additionally features a lightweight, die-cast light weight aluminum block that reduces overall weight, causing enhanced car dynamics and velocity capacities.
